I know the fault is on my side but this is the only website which does not load, everysingle other website loads perfectly, so I am at a loss on what to do...

I already mentioned what should be the issue and the solution.
It sounds like something related to the DNS service your internet connection uses.

I recommend using the 8.8.8.8 DNS service from Google.

So:
1. Press Win+R, type "ncpa.cpl", then press Enter.
1635851439355.png


2. Right click the network adapter that you're using to connect to internet, and click Properties.
1635851510596.png


3. Double click "Internet Protocol Version 4", and choose "Use the following DNS server addresses". In the "Preferred DNS server" put "8.8.8.8".
1635851622741.png


4. Click OK, and exit all the open windows. Do Win+R again, type "ipconfig /flushdns", and press Enter.

Everything should be fine afterwards.

You can read more about Google DNS, here: https://developers.google.com/speed/public-dns
